What are some strategies for couples to align their financial goals?
In this episode, Ben Matthews shares a family-friendly framework for managing money without constant stress or arguments. He introduces the “Level-Up Money Plan” and mixes in negotiation wisdom from Chris Voss to make money talks easier. From automatic savings to setting up fun funds, this episode is packed with real-world advice for couples juggling debt, kids, and chaos.
Topics Ben explores in this episode:
(0:27) The Level-Up Money Plan
* Traditional budgeting is out; the Level-Up Money Plan is a more flexible, family-friendly approach.
* Automate bill payments, savings, and “fun money” to reduce financial stress and arguments.
(2:36) If Your Partner Isn’t Onboard
* Financial talks with a resistant husband or wife don't have to be war zones.
* View money conversations as a way to build partnership, not assign blame.
(4:07) Psychology of Money Talks
* Frame conversations using “loss aversion” to make saving feel like a choice, not a punishment.
* Build a “sh!t happens fund” to turn financial emergencies into minor hiccups.
(8:06) Listener Question
* Most people who file bankruptcy aren't irresponsible—they’re hit by life’s curveballs.
* Helping people avoid bankruptcy is Ben’s real mission, even if it means fewer clients.
(10:07) When You Need More Than a Plan
* If debt has you underwater, bankruptcy can be a reset, not a failure.
